New Minimum Wage Law Could Either Sink Or Revive FL Economy

Reply(1) Florida voters passed controversial legislation that experts say will either revive or destroy the state s economy. (Shutterstock) FLORIDA With the coronavirus pandemic cutting the 2020 Florida legislative session short, Florida political leaders admitted this wasn t the year to promote new agendas and tackle groundbreaking statutes. However, Florida voters didn t need their elected representatives to pass controversial legislation that, depending upon the politics of the prognosticator, could either save or destroy the state. During Nov. 3 s general election, 60 percent of Florida voters approved Amendment 2 to the Florida Constitution, which raises the minimum wage rate over the next six years from its current rate of $8.56 per hour to $15 an hour.
